Hi Dave
The 1000k-200k closing times are the same as the 1200k up to Tobin Resort
inbound. Thereafter you must follow the closing times for a normal 200k.
These are listed on the Rider Progress page of the web site.
http://davisbikeclub.org/goldrush/riderprogress.htm
Basically, since we don't know what time you will start your 200k, the times
are just Start Time + an offset.
About the 1000+200k option, some brief rules:
1) the 1000k portion ends at Tobin, there are 14 riders signed up for this
option. They have separate cards. When a 1000k rider arrives at Tobin,
they must check in as if its the end of their ride. They will not turn in
their card, however, since the 1000k and 200k are on one card.
2) The Tobin control will initial and enter the start time for the 200k
section, to be written on the card, when the rider leaves Tobin. Rider may
take a break without time penalty for the 200k portion at Tobin before
starting the 200k brevet.
3) Rider must start the 200k portion before you close the control at the
stated time for 1200k riders or 1000k riders, whichever is last.
4) In order to get a GRR jersey, the 1000k-200k rider's TOTAL time for the
ENTIRE distance, including any downtime at Tobin, must be under 90 hours,
just like the GRR riders.
5) Riders that decide to quit at Tobin with just a 1000k should sign and
leave their card at Tobin and find their own way back to Davis, or wait for
infrequent, unknown time when Sag or support crew is going through Tobin.
